Meet the Veggie: Watermelon Radish


The watermelon radish grows to be about three inches across, displaying a white outer skin at the top with green shoulders and a pink base that covers a red to magenta inner flesh. This vibrant surprise center is bright enough to cheer up the dreariest of salads. Cook this radish much like you would a turnip - creamed and served as a side dish, sautéed and braised to be served as a vegetable dish, or added to stir-fry dishes.
